Introduction to Commercial Lighting Brightness Standards
Commercial lighting brightness standards are set by organizations such as the Illuminating Engineering Society (IES) and the International Commission on Illumination (CIE). These standards define the minimum and maximum levels of light intensity required for different types of commercial spaces. The primary goal is to ensure that the lighting is sufficient to perform tasks safely and comfortably, while also considering energy efficiency and environmental impact.
Importance of Commercial Lighting Brightness Standards
The implementation of commercial lighting brightness standards is vital for several reasons:
1. Safety: Adequate lighting is essential for preventing accidents and ensuring the safety of individuals in commercial spaces. Poor lighting can lead to tripping hazards, increased risk of falls, and reduced visibility, which can be particularly dangerous in emergency situations.
2. Productivity: Proper lighting can enhance productivity by reducing eye strain and fatigue, which are common issues in poorly lit environments. Employees and customers are more likely to be comfortable and focused when the lighting is appropriate for the task at hand.
3. Energy Efficiency: By adhering to brightness standards, commercial spaces can use lighting systems that are designed to provide the necessary illumination with minimal energy consumption. This not only reduces operational costs but also helps in reducing the carbon footprint.
4. Aesthetics: Lighting can significantly impact the ambiance and aesthetic appeal of a commercial space. Standards ensure that lighting is used effectively to enhance the overall look and feel of the environment.
Factors Influencing Commercial Lighting Brightness Standards
Several factors influence the determination of commercial lighting brightness standards:
1. Activity Level: Different activities require different levels of illumination. For example, retail stores may need higher levels of lighting to showcase products effectively, while office spaces may require lower levels to reduce eye strain.
2. Space Type: The type of commercial space also plays a role in determining the lighting standards. Public buildings, healthcare facilities, and educational institutions have specific requirements that differ from those of retail or office spaces.
3. Geographical Location: The amount of natural light available in a particular region can influence the lighting requirements. Areas with less natural light may require higher levels of artificial illumination.
4. Energy Efficiency Regulations: Government regulations and energy efficiency codes can also impact the lighting standards. These regulations often require the use of energy-efficient lighting technologies to reduce overall energy consumption.
Types of Commercial Lighting Systems
Commercial lighting systems are designed to meet the brightness standards and cater to different needs. Some common types include:
1. Tubular Fluorescent Lighting: Widely used in offices and retail spaces, these systems provide a consistent and uniform light distribution.
2. LED Lighting: Known for their energy efficiency and long lifespan, LED lighting systems are becoming increasingly popular in commercial applications.
3. High Bay Lighting: Used in warehouses and large retail spaces, high bay lighting systems provide intense illumination over a wide area.
4. Low Bay Lighting: Ideal for areas with a lower ceiling height, low bay lighting systems offer focused lighting without the need for excessive brightness.
Measuring and Testing Lighting Levels
To ensure that commercial spaces meet the brightness standards, lighting levels are measured and tested using specialized equipment. Lumens, lux, and foot-candles are common units used to measure light intensity. The following steps are typically involved in the process:
1. Site Survey: A detailed survey of the commercial space is conducted to identify the lighting requirements for different areas.
2. Lighting Design: Based on the survey, a lighting design is created that specifies the type and placement of lighting fixtures.
3. Installation: The lighting fixtures are installed according to the design specifications.
4. Testing: Post-installation, the lighting levels are tested to ensure they meet the brightness standards.
